The Croswell Swinging Bridge is an iconic suspension bridge located in Riverbend Park, Michigan. This unique tourist attraction offers visitors breathtaking views and an exhilarating experience as they cross the swaying structure. Perfect for adventure seekers and nature lovers alike, the bridge is a must-see for anyone visiting the area.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Croswell Swinging Bridge.
- Visit early in the morning or late afternoon for fewer crowds and stunning lighting for photography.
- Wear comfortable shoes as the bridge can sway, and the nearby trails may be uneven.
- Bring a picnic to enjoy in Riverbend Park after your bridge adventure.
- Check local weather conditions before your visit, as rain can make the bridge slippery.

Getting There
-
Car
If you're driving, head towards Croswell, Michigan. From any point in The Thumb, take the M-25 highway heading towards Croswell. Once you enter Croswell, look for the signs directing you to Riverbend Park. Turn onto Maple St, where you will find the entrance to Riverbend Park. The Croswell Swinging Bridge is located within the park. There is no entry fee for the park itself, but be aware of possible parking fees depending on the time of your visit.
-
Public Transportation
For those relying on public transportation, check local bus services that operate in The Thumb region. You can take a bus to the nearest major hub, which is in Port Huron. From Port Huron, you may need to arrange for a taxi or rideshare service to take you the remaining 22 miles to Croswell. Ensure you check bus schedules beforehand, as they may vary. There may be costs associated with bus fares and ride-sharing services.
-
Bicycle
If you're feeling adventurous and wish to bike, you can follow the M-25 route towards Croswell, which has designated bike lanes in certain sections. Make sure to wear a helmet and follow traffic laws. The distance from most locations in The Thumb to Croswell is about 20-30 miles, so plan for a leisurely ride. Remember to bring water and snacks, and expect to spend several hours biking, depending on your pace.
